Players can create dice tokens on map by dragging icons from the dice roll in the chat window

I am not sure if this is intended behavior, but a player can execute a roll in the chat window, and then drag the die icon to the tabletop to create a token. They can then edit properties (double click token), as well as delete the token (using the delete key on the keyboard). Is there any reason for this behavior that I am missing? Or is this a (very minor) bug? I tried searching the forums but was not able to find anything related. Thanks! -Chris
It's intended. Some games use the dice as actual pieces for gameplay.
